First Response Service (FRS) are looking for applications from Registered mental health Nurses for our 24/ 7 Mental Health Crisis Assessment Service. The service offers support to the diverse population of Bradford, Airedale, Wharfedale and Craven.

The Service is ageless and includes assessments for working age adults, older people, Children and Adolescents and Women in the Perinatal Period who are experiencing a mental health crisis ensuring that people can access the right help in a timely way.

Main duties of the job

The candidate will need to be an experienced practitioner in mental Health acute care, providing high quality crisis assessment in any environment, both in person and over the phone. They will lead shifts and be called on to manage staff, presenting themselves as a role model and agent of change to the team.

Key to the service is its relationships with its stakeholders and as such diplomacy and an empathy for other services pressures while at the same time promoting mental health is essential.
